🧱 Key Pricing Components
- ✓ Inspection and testing — Most pros will assess the affected area, identify the mold type, and check moisture levels to determine the scope of work.
- ✓ Containment setup — Creating physical barriers and using negative air pressure to prevent mold spores from spreading to unaffected areas during removal.
- ✓ Air filtration — High-efficiency HEPA filtration equipment to capture airborne spores and improve indoor air quality throughout the remediation process.
- ✓ Removal and disposal — Physically removing contaminated materials such as drywall, insulation, or carpeting, followed by proper disposal per local regulations.
- ✓ Cleaning and antimicrobial treatment — Cleaning salvageable surfaces and applying antimicrobial agents to prevent future mold growth.
- ✓ Repairs and restoration — Rebuilding or replacing removed structures like drywall, trim, or flooring, which is often billed separately from the remediation work.
Typical Mold Remediation Costs
Average pricing for common services in Newville
Mold remediation costs in Newville typically vary based on the size of the affected area and the complexity of the job.
Small areas (less than 10 sq ft), such as a bathroom corner or small closet, are often the most affordable and may be handled as a single-visit project.
Moderate infestations (10 to 50 sq ft), like a basement wall or larger ceiling spot, involve more containment and removal steps, increasing labor and material costs.
Extensive issues (50+ sq ft or HVAC-related contamination) require full containment, longer project timelines, and often coordination with contractors for structural repairs — these represent the higher end of local pricing.
No matter the scope, always request an in-person inspection before agreeing to any price. Phone estimates for mold work are rarely accurate.

💬 Does homeowners insurance cover mold remediation in Newville?
Coverage varies widely by policy. Most standard homeowners insurance in Alabama excludes mold damage unless it's directly caused by a covered peril like a burst pipe. Flood-related mold is almost never covered under standard policies. Always check with your insurance provider and ask your remediation pro for documentation to support any claim.
💬 How long does mold remediation typically take in Newville?
A small bathroom or closet job may be completed in one day. Moderate projects often take 2 to 4 days including setup, removal, and drying time. Extensive whole-home or HVAC mold issues can take a week or longer depending on the complexity and any needed structural repairs.
💬 Do I need to leave my home during mold remediation?
For small, contained areas, you may be able to stay in the home as long as you avoid the work zone. For moderate to large projects involving negative air pressure containment, it's often recommended to vacate — especially for children, elderly individuals, or anyone with respiratory conditions. Your remediation pro will advise based on the scope.
💬 Can I just clean the mold myself instead of hiring a pro?
Small patches (under 10 sq ft) of surface mold on non-porous surfaces can sometimes be cleaned with detergent and water. However, larger infestations, hidden mold in walls or HVAC systems, or any black mold requires professional handling to ensure complete removal and to prevent spores from spreading throughout your home.
💬 What causes mold issues in Newville homes?
Newville's humid subtropical climate creates ideal conditions for mold growth. Common causes include leaky roofs or pipes, poor bathroom ventilation, basement moisture, flooding from heavy rains, and high indoor humidity levels. Identifying and fixing the moisture source is critical to preventing recurrence.
